ANTENNA TUNER OPERATION
■
Optional AT-180
automatic
antenna
tuner
operation
The AT-180 automatic antenna tuner matches the
IC-7200 to the connected antenna automatically.
Once the tuner matches an antenna, the variable
capacitor settings are memorized as a preset point
for each frequency range (100 kHz steps). Therefore,
when you change the frequency range, the variable
capacitors are automatically preset to the memorized
point.
NOTE:
• The AT-180 can match both HF and 50 MHz
bands. However, operation is different for the HF
and 50 MHz bands.
• When connecting the AT-180, the IC-7200’s out-
put power must be more than 10 W. Otherwise,
the AT-180 may not be tuned correctly. (AT-180’s
minimum operating input power is 8 W.)
CAUTION:
NEVER
transmit with the tuner ON
when no antenna is connected. This will damage
both the transceiver and antenna tuner.

Tuner operation
• For the HF band:
Push
TUNER
to turn the tuner ON. The antenna is
tuned automatically during transmission when the
antenna SWR is higher than 1.5:1.
• When the tuner is ON, “
” indication appears.
• For the 50 MHz band:
Push and hold
TUNER
for 1 sec. to tune the antenna.

D
Manual tuning
During SSB operation on HF bands at low voice lev-
els, the AT-180 may not be tuned correctly. In such
cases, manual tuning is helpful.
Push and hold
TUNER
for 1 sec. to start manual tun-
ing.

If the tuner cannot reduce the SWR to less than
1.5:1 after 20 sec. of tuning,
“
”
indicator disap-
pears. In this case, check the following:
• the antenna connection and feedline
• the antenna SWR (p. 30; meter function, p. 60;
Measuring SWR)
Through inhibit
(HF bands only)
The AT-180 has a through inhibit condition. When
selecting this condition, the tuner can be used at
poor SWR’s. In this case, automatic tuning in the
HF bands activates only when exceeding SWR 3:1.
Therefore, manual tuning is necessary each time you
change the frequency. Although termed “through in-
hibit,” the tuner will be set to the “through” configura-
tion if the SWR is higher than 3:1 after tuning.

• PTT tune function
(p. 76)
The AT-180 is tuned when [PTT] is pushed after the
frequency is changed (more than 1%) if the AT-180 is
turned ON. This function removes the “push and hold
TUNER
” operation and activates first transmission
on the new frequency.
This function is turned ON in the set mode.
